    SAN JOSE, Calif. -- USF scored twice in the fourth inning and three times in the fifth en route to a 6-2 non-conference win over San Jose State Thursday night at Municipal Stadium.

    USF third baseman Taggert Bozied increased his hitting streak to 20 games with three hits including two doubles. His two-run double in the fifth inning capped the Dons scoring. Danny Trumble added two hits for USF.

    Bozied led off the second with a single and later scored on an error for a 1-0 USF lead. San Jose State tied the score in the bottom of the inning when John Fagan led off with a triple and scored on Jamie Hiegel's sacrifice fly.

    The Dons scored two runs on three hits in the fourth to regain the lead,

    and added three in the fifth.

    Tony Tognetti's sacrifice fly plated Brandon Macchi for SJSU's other run.

    Both teams had seven hits in the game, but USF also took advantage of four Spartan errors.

    USF hosts Santa Clara Saturday and Sunday in a three-game West Coast Conference series. The Dons also host San Jose State next Tuesday in a make-up of a of a Feb. 15 contest which was rained out.
